Optimal Soaking Conditions: Temperature and Time
To maximize the effectiveness of soaking, it’s crucial to get the water temperature and soaking time just right.
The Ideal Water Temperature
Hot water, but not scalding, is the sweet spot.
Hot water molecules move faster than cold water molecules, accelerating the rehydration process.
However, scalding water can potentially damage certain pan types or cause burns.
Aim for a temperature that’s comfortable to the touch but noticeably warm.
Determining the Right Soaking Time
Patience is key here.
The soaking time will depend on the severity of the burn.
For lightly burnt sugar, 30 minutes to an hour may suffice.
However, if the sugar is heavily burnt and deeply ingrained, you may need to soak the pan overnight.
Regularly check the pan to assess the sugar’s progress.
If the water cools down significantly during soaking, consider replacing it with fresh hot water to maintain optimal conditions.

Creating and Applying the Baking Soda Paste
The key to unlocking baking soda’s cleaning power lies in creating the right paste. Here’s how:
-
In a small bowl, combine baking soda with just enough water to form a thick, spreadable paste. The consistency should be similar to that of toothpaste.
-
Apply the paste generously to the affected areas of the pan, ensuring that all the burnt sugar is completely covered.
-
Allow the paste to sit on the burnt sugar for at least 30 minutes. For particularly stubborn cases, you can even let it sit overnight.

The Boiling Method: Unleashing Heat’s Power on Stubborn Sugar
Sometimes, even the best soaking and scrubbing just won’t cut it. This is when escalating to the boiling method becomes necessary. Boiling water can penetrate and lift even the most stubbornly adhered burnt sugar, often making the difference between a ruined pan and a salvaged one.
How Boiling Works Its Magic
The science is simple: heat expands, and water penetrates. As the water heats up within the pan, it works its way under the burnt sugar. The heat loosens the bond between the sugar and the pan’s surface. This, combined with the agitation of the boiling water, helps to dislodge even the most persistent residue.
The Boiling Process: A Step-by-Step Guide
Here’s how to put the boiling method into action:
-
Fill the Pan: Cover the burnt sugar with water. Make sure all affected areas are submerged.
-
Add Baking Soda (Optional): For an extra boost, add a tablespoon or two of baking soda to the water. The baking soda will enhance the cleaning power of the boiling water.
-
Bring to a Boil: Place the pan on the stovetop and bring the water to a rolling boil.
-
Simmer and Scrape: Let the water simmer for 10-15 minutes, or until you see the burnt sugar begin to loosen. Use a wooden spoon or spatula to gently scrape the loosened sugar while the water is still hot. Be careful not to scratch the pan!

The Vinegar and Water Simmering Method: A Step-by-Step Guide
Using vinegar to clean a burnt pan is surprisingly simple. This method utilizes heat to enhance vinegar’s cleaning power, providing an extra boost for dissolving the stubborn sugar. Here’s how to do it:
-
Mix it Up: Combine equal parts white vinegar and water in the affected pan. A 1:1 ratio is generally effective, but you can adjust the amounts depending on the size of the pan and the extent of the burning.
-
Simmer Slowly: Place the pan on the stovetop over medium heat. Bring the mixture to a gentle simmer. You should see small bubbles forming, but the mixture shouldn’t be at a rolling boil.
-
Simmer Time: Let the vinegar and water simmer for 5-10 minutes. Keep a close eye on the pan. The duration depends on the severity of the burnt sugar. You should notice the residue starting to loosen and lift from the surface.
-
Scrape Away: Carefully remove the pan from the heat and let it cool slightly. Use a non-abrasive spatula or scraper to gently dislodge the loosened sugar. It should come off much more easily than before.
-
Wash and Rinse: Once you’ve removed the majority of the burnt sugar, wash the pan with soap and water as usual. Rinse thoroughly to remove any remaining vinegar residue.
Important Notes and Considerations
- Ventilation is Key: When simmering vinegar, ensure good ventilation in your kitchen. The fumes can be quite strong and may irritate your eyes or respiratory system. Open a window or turn on your range hood to circulate the air.
- Not for All Pans: While vinegar is generally safe for most cookware, avoid using it on pans with reactive surfaces like aluminum or cast iron. Prolonged exposure to acid can damage these materials. Always test in an inconspicuous area first.
- Stubborn Spots: For particularly stubborn spots, you can try creating a paste of baking soda and vinegar after simmering. Apply the paste to the affected areas and let it sit for a few minutes before scrubbing gently.

The Low and Slow Approach: Mastering Heat Control
One of the biggest culprits behind burnt sugar is excessive heat. High heat accelerates the caramelization process, quickly pushing it past the point of golden-brown deliciousness and into the realm of burnt and bitter.
Opt for lower heat settings, especially when dealing with delicate sugar-based recipes. Patience is key; allow the sugar to melt and caramelize gradually. This approach provides more control and reduces the risk of scorching.
Stir, Stir, Stir: The Power of Constant Motion
Stirring is your best friend when working with sugar. Constant motion prevents the sugar from settling and overheating in one spot.
Use a heat-resistant spatula or wooden spoon to scrape the bottom and sides of the pan regularly. This ensures even heat distribution and prevents localized burning. Don’t neglect the corners of the pan, where sugar tends to accumulate.
Mindful Cooking: Paying Attention to the Process
Burning sugar often happens when we become distracted. Sugary mixtures require your undivided attention. Avoid multitasking or stepping away from the stove while cooking.
Keep a close eye on the color and consistency of the sugar. Be ready to adjust the heat or remove the pan from the burner if you notice any signs of burning. Trust your senses – if you smell something burning, it probably is!
The Right Tools for the Job: Choosing the Right Pan
The type of pan you use can also significantly impact your chances of burning sugar. Thin-bottomed pans are prone to hot spots, leading to uneven heating and increased risk of burning.
Heavy-Bottomed Benefits
Invest in heavy-bottomed pans made from materials like stainless steel or cast iron. These pans distribute heat more evenly, minimizing the risk of scorching.
Material Matters
Consider the material of your pan. Stainless steel is a good choice for general cooking, while copper offers excellent heat conductivity (though it can be more expensive). Avoid using non-stick pans for high-heat sugar work, as the coating can degrade over time and release harmful chemicals.

Burned Sugar SOS: Cleaning FAQs
Here are some frequently asked questions to help you tackle that burned sugar situation in your pan.
What’s the best way to loosen really stubborn burned sugar?
For extremely stubborn cases, try letting the pan soak overnight. Fill it with water and add a tablespoon of baking soda. The extended soak softens the burned sugar, making it easier to scrape off in the morning. It’s a great way to get burnt sugar off a pan without excessive scrubbing.
Can I use something other than vinegar to clean burned sugar?
Yes! Lemon juice is a great alternative to vinegar. The acidity in lemon juice works similarly to loosen the residue. You can boil lemon juice and water in the pan just like you would with vinegar, then scrape away the softened burned sugar.
Will steel wool scratch my pan when trying to remove burned sugar?
It’s best to avoid steel wool, especially on non-stick or delicate surfaces. Steel wool can scratch the pan. Instead, try using a plastic or nylon scrubber, or a wooden spoon to gently scrape away the loosened burned sugar. A paste of baking soda and water can also act as a mild abrasive without causing scratches.
How can I prevent sugar from burning in the first place?
Constant stirring is key when working with sugar. Use low to medium heat and keep a close eye on the pan. Using a heavier-bottomed pan can also help distribute heat more evenly, reducing the risk of burning. Preventative measures are the best way to avoid the hassle of cleaning burned sugar off a pan.
